LG Optimus G beast phone unleashed: Galaxy S3 killer?
We saw the LG Optimus G Android phone teased last week, but now it’s official, and as we predicted, it’s a beast. It’s packing the specs to make even the powerhouse Samsung Galaxy S3 look feeble – and it’s coming to the UK before Christmas. Read on for all the details.
In its home country of South Korea this morning, LG’s announced the LG Optimus G, its next generation Android 4.0 smartphone. It’s just 8.45mm thin, with a lavish 4.7-inch HD resolution (1280×720) display, and a 13 megapixel camera.

What’s most impressive is what’s under the hood however. It’s packing the latest second generation quad-core 1.5GHz processor from Qualcomm, which looks to be the new fastest kid on the block, as well as 2GB of memory, which should make multitasking a breeze. That’s all backed up by a beefy 2,100mAh battery to help the LG Optimus G last through the day.
The LG Optimus G is out in South Korea in September, with a global launch before the end of the year. What do you make of this new phone? Should Samsung be scared? Let’s hear your thoughts in the comments.
